Types of Hardwood Floor Finishes
Surface finishes like polyurethanes form a protective film on top, while penetrating finishes like oils soak into the wood for a natural feel. Factory-applied options, such as aluminum oxide, dominate 2026 trends for prefinished floors, per Garrison Collection's April 2026 report.
- Oil-based polyurethane: Amber tint, excellent durability, ideal for busy households.
- Water-based polyurethane: Clear finish, low VOCs, quick dry time.
- Hardwax oil: Penetrates wood, easy spot repairs, enhances grain.
- Aluminum oxide: Factory finish, extreme scratch resistance, often UV-cured.
- Moisture-cured polyurethane: Highly moisture-resistant, professional use only.
- Wax: Traditional, low luster, high maintenance.

Pros and Cons Lists
Oil-Based Polyurethane Pros
- Forms thick protective layer lasting 10-15 years in moderate traffic.
- Amber hue warms wood tones, hiding scratches better.
- Cost-effective at $3.75-$5 per square foot installed.
Oil-based polyurethane dominated 60% of installations in 2025, per Wood Flooring Doctor's January 2026 analysis, due to its proven track record since the 1970s.
Oil-Based Polyurethane Cons
- Strong fumes require 48-72 hour ventilation; yellows over time.
- Slower drying-full cure in 7 days.
- Harder to repair locally.

Penetrating Finishes Deep Dive
Hardwax oil penetrates 1-2mm into wood pores, hardening for a matte, natural aesthetic favored in 2026 Scandinavian designs. Unlike surface films, it allows wood to breathe, reducing cupping by 30% in humid climates per 2024 NWFA tests.

Factory vs. Site-Finished
- Factory-finished (e.g., aluminum oxide): Applied pre-install, walkable immediately, 25% more durable per Hardwood Info Council.
- Site-finished: Custom colors, but 3-7 days downtime.
- Hybrid: UV-cured site finishes combine speed and customization.
Aluminum oxide, introduced in factory lines in 1998, now covers 70% of prefinished sales, resisting 5x more scratches than site polys.
Sheen and Color Options
Sheen levels-matte (least visible scratches), satin, semi-gloss, gloss-affect light reflection and wear perception. Matte finishes rose 40% in 2026 for their footprint-hiding properties, per Garrison trends.
- Matte: Hides dust, low sheen.
- Satin: Balances shine and matte (most popular).
- Semi-gloss: Reflects light in dim rooms.
- Gloss: Dramatic, shows imperfections.

Application Steps
- Sand to 120 grit, vacuum thoroughly.
- Apply stain if desired, dry 4-6 hours.
- 2-4 thin coats of finish, 2-24 hours between.
- Light buff between coats for pros.
- Cure 3-7 days before heavy use.
